1. Launch Microsoft Outlook. In this demonstration, we are using Microsoft Outlook 2016.


Image Placeholder


2. If this is the first time you’ve opened Outlook, you’ll see a Welcome page. Click Next to get started.


Image Placeholder


If you’ve used Outlook before, then go to File > Add Account.


Image Placeholder


3. Select Yes when prompted about setting up Outlook to connect to an email account and click Next.


Image Placeholder


4. Select Manual Setup or Additional Server Types and hit Next.


Image Placeholder


5. Select Manual Setup or Additional Server Types and click Next.


Image Placeholder

6. In the Add Account window, enter the following information:


User Information

Your Name: Your Name or Business Name
Email Address: Your Mailbox Email Address
Account Type: IMAP
Incoming Mail Server: secure.emailsrvr.com
Outgoing Mail Server: secure.emailsrvr.com


Logon Information

User Name: Your Mailbox Email Address
Password: Your Mailbox Password

7. Once done, click More Settings.


Image Placeholder


8. Switch to Outgoing Server, check My Outgoing Server (SMTP) Requires Authentication and select Use Same Settings as my Incoming Mail Server.


Image Placeholder


9. Change Use the Following Type of Encrypted Connection to SSL for both the Incoming and Outgoing Servers. Next, change the Incoming Server (IMAP) port to 993, the Outgoing Server (SMTP) port to 465, and click OK.


Image Placeholder


10. Click Next.


Image Placeholder


11. Outlook will now attempt a small test by sending a text message using our configurations. If everything was configured correctly, the message would send out successfully. Click Close.


Image Placeholder


12. Finally, click Finish to close the setup wizard.


Image Placeholder


Congratulations! You have successfully configured your Rackspace mailbox with Microsoft Outlook. The syncing process between Outlook and your mailbox may take some time based on the amount of email data to be fetched.
